 Pomfret, Connecticut -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Pomfret is a town located in Windham County, Connecticut.
Pomfret has no formal town center; the town office is located on US Route 44.
The Congregational Church stands on the eastern edge of the old town green on Pomfret Hill, across from the Pomfret School, founded in 1898.

 Pomfret, Connecticut
The settlement was known by the Indian name Massamugget until 1713 when the town was incorporated, and later called Pomfret, named after Pontefract in Yorkshire, England.
Pomfret is probably best known historically for the Wolf Den where General Israel Putnam killed the last wolf in Connecticut.

 Town-USA Pomfret Connecticut   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-31)
The town of Pomfret is located in northeast Connecticut, it covers about 40 square miles and is home to approximately 3,300 residents.
Pomfret is about a one hour drive from Hartford the capital of Connecticut, and about a one hour drive to Providence Rhode Island.
Pomfret is probably best know historically for the Wolf Den where General Israel Putnam killed the last wolf in Connecticut which now the State of Connecticut maintains as a State Park.

 M.A.P.S. Program Comes to Pomfret
In addition to the Bafflin Sanctuary in Pomfret, seasonal bird banding is also conducted at other Connecticut Audubon locations; Birdcraft Museum in Fairfield and the CAS Coastal Center at Milford Point.
The M.A.P. Program at Pomfret is part of a nationwide bird-monitoring project, a cooperative effort between government and private organizations that provides critical information gathered by trained local volunteers on population and demographic parameters for up to100 target land birds.

 Pomfret Connecticut : About Pomfret
omfret is a small rural town located in picturesque Northeastern Connecticut with a population of approximately 3836 residents.
The town was incorporated in 1713 and has changed from a rural agricultural town to a rural residential one with some light industry.
Many historic buildings and landmarks exist in Pomfret and are preserved for future generations to view and enjoy.
